1. Begin With a Warm Neutral Foundation

Start with cream, beige, warm white, taupe, or soft greige. These colors reflect light and make a compact room feel calmer and more open.

Then introduce warmth through wood, woven baskets, linen curtains, and textured cushions. This simple foundation also gives you more freedom to change decorative accents later.

2. Let the Sofa Become the Comfort Zone

Your sofa usually becomes the visual and functional anchor of the room. Choose one that provides enough seating without swallowing the available floor space.

For a small apartment, a compact sofa with clean lines can work beautifully. Add two or three cushions and a soft throw to make the seating area feel relaxed rather than overly formal.

3. Define the Room With an Area Rug

A rug can visually connect your furniture and make the room feel finished. It also adds softness underfoot, which matters in an apartment where hard floors can sometimes make the space feel cold.

Choose a rug large enough to sit beneath at least the front legs of your main seating. A subtle pattern can also hide everyday marks.

4. Layer Your Lighting for Evening Comfort

One ceiling light rarely creates the atmosphere you want. Instead, combine a floor lamp, table lamp, wall lighting, or small accent lights.

Warm lighting instantly changes the mood. Therefore, place lamps near seating areas and dark corners so the room feels welcoming from every angle.

6. Make a Small Apartment Living Room Feel Larger

The secret is not simply using white furniture. Instead, focus on visual breathing room.

Try these simple changes:

  • Keep walkways clear.
  • Choose furniture with visible legs.
  • Use one large mirror.
  • Avoid filling every surface.
  • Keep window areas open.
  • Repeat a small number of colors.

These choices can make a surprisingly big difference.

12. Choose Furniture That Does More Than One Job

Small apartments demand smart choices. Look for an ottoman that provides storage, a coffee table with drawers, nesting tables, or a sofa that can accommodate overnight guests.

Consequently, every major piece earns its place while reducing clutter.

16. Hang Curtains Higher for a Taller Look

Curtains can change the proportions of a room. Mount them slightly above the window and let them reach close to the floor.

Light curtains can also soften harsh sunlight while maintaining an airy feeling. This small adjustment works particularly well in apartments with low ceilings.

18. Create Zones in an Open Apartment

Studio apartments often combine the living room, bedroom, dining area, and kitchen into one space. You can still create visual boundaries.

Use a rug beneath the sofa, a narrow console behind seating, or an open bookshelf as a divider. This gives each area a purpose without closing off the room.

20. Keep Your Decor Rental Friendly

Renters can still personalize their homes. Use removable hooks, freestanding shelves, peel and stick options, leaning mirrors, and artwork that does not require permanent changes.

Before making any changes, check your rental agreement. A beautiful room should never create an avoidable problem when it is time to move.

8 Practical Tips for Better Apartment Living Room Decor

When decorating a small home, these simple rules can save both money and space:

  1. Measure furniture before buying it.
  2. Keep at least one clear walking path.
  3. Choose pieces with hidden storage.
  4. Use mirrors to increase visual depth.
  5. Layer lighting instead of relying on one fixture.
  6. Repeat two or three main colors throughout the room.
  7. Decorate vertical surfaces when floor space is limited.
  8. Buy fewer but more useful decorative accents.

These steps make apartment living room decor more functional while still allowing your personality to shine.

What Are the Biggest Small Living Room Decorating Mistakes?

The most common mistakes include choosing oversized furniture, blocking windows, filling every wall, using only one light source, and adding too many small accessories.

Instead, focus on scale, function, and visual balance. Every item should either serve a purpose or add something meaningful to the room.

A Simple Step by Step Way to Create Your Dream Room

If you feel overwhelmed, do not decorate everything at once. Follow this order:

First, measure the room and identify your main problem. Next, choose your color palette and arrange the largest furniture pieces. Then add your rug, lighting, curtains, and storage.

After that, bring in plants, artwork, textiles, and decorative accents. Finally, remove anything that feels unnecessary.

This process keeps your budget under control and helps you see exactly what your space needs.
